Which is your best side? Your left?
A study by Kelsey Blackburn and James Schriillo from Wake Forest University found that the left side of peoples’ faces are perceived and rates as more aesthetically pleasing than the right. They theorize that this is due to the fact that we perhaps present a greater intensity of emotion on the left side of our faces.
Perhaps this is something you should consider when you take your portrait photographs!
